Meet the €700 330i, Rust Edition

Found this beauty for 700 euro. I love the touring shape E46, completely in love with it.

Interior is really clean for the mileage (260k kms). It also has the pretty rare Nappa leather with extended leather on the door cards, HK and black headliner.

DSC yaw sensor is bad, have that coming my way and apart from the she runs and drives great. Shifts nicely and she pulls.

The enemy here would always be rust. I found new front panels/fenders in this color. The back would either be a bondo job or overfender, nor sure yet.

Yesterday I went and checked around the jacking points on a lift as that would be the main point of MOT failure in the Netherlands. They are quite crusty. I have to save those first before proceeding with anything else.

I was (foolishly) thinking this could maybe, possibily and probably (not😅) be done without welding. Turns out it does.
